    Dante looks longingly at Beatrice Portinari (in yellow) as she passes by him with Lady Vanna (in red).

    https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Unrequited_love

    Eric Berne considered that “the man who is loved by a woman is lucky indeed, but the one to be envied is he who loves, however little he gets in return. How much greater is Dante gazing at Beatrice than Beatrice walking by him in apparent disdain”.

    **

    Unrequited love or one-sided love is love that is not openly reciprocated or understood as such by the beloved. The beloved may not be aware of the admirer’s deep and strong romantic affection, or may consciously reject it.

    ベアトリーチェ (Beatrice Portinari)

    ダンテを代表する最初の詩文作品、『新生』によれば、1274年5月1日に催された春の祭りカレンディマッジョ(Calendimaggio)の中で、ダンテは同い年の少女ベアトリーチェ・ポルティナーリ(イタリア語版)に出会い、魂を奪われるかのような感動を覚えたと言う。この時、ダンテは9歳であった。

    それから9年の時を経て、共に18歳になったダンテとベアトリーチェは、聖トリニタ橋のたもとで再会した。その時ベアトリーチェは会釈してすれ違ったのみで、一言の会話も交さなかったが、以来ダンテはベアトリーチェに熱病に冒されたように恋焦がれた。しかしこの恋心を他人に悟られないように、別の二人の女性に宛てて「とりとめのない詩数篇」を作る。その結果、ダンテの周囲には色々な風説が流れ、感情を害したベアトリーチェは挨拶すら拒むようになった。こうしてダンテは、深い失望のうちに時を過ごした。1285年頃に、ダンテは許婚のジェンマ・ドナーティ(イタリア語版)と結婚した。

    二人の間にさしたる交流もないまま、ベアトリーチェもある銀行家に嫁ぎ、数人の子供をもうけて1290年に24歳で病死した。彼女の死を知ったダンテは狂乱状態に陥り、キケロやボエティウスなどの古典を読み耽って心の痛手を癒そうとした。そして生涯をかけてベアトリーチェを詩の中に永遠の存在として賛美していくことを誓い、生前の彼女のことをうたった詩をまとめて『新生』を著した。その後、生涯をかけて『神曲』三篇を執筆し、この中でベアトリーチェを天国に坐して主人公ダンテを助ける永遠の淑女として描いた。

    Beatrice and Dante

    https://www.florenceinferno.com/beatrice-portinari/

    Beatrice was Dante’s true love. In his Vita Nova, Dante reveals that he saw Beatrice for the first time when his father took him to the Portinari house for a May Day party. They were children: he was nine years old and she was eight.
    Dante was instantly smitten and never forgot her after this meeting even though he married another woman, Gemma Donati, in 1285, with whom he had three sons and one daughter.

    According to tradition, Dante and Beatrice were also neighbors outside the walls of Florence—near the hill of Fiesole, where the Portinari and Alighieri families had two neighboring summer villas. It is plausible that Dante and Beatrice met each other as children there.

    He would meet her again nine years later in an unexpected fashion: Beatrice was walking along dressed in white and accompanied by two older women on Lungarno (one of the Florence streets along the Arno River).

    She turned and greeted him. Dante remembered the episode well, but ran away without saying a word.

    Her salutation filled him with such joy that he retreated to his room to think about her. In so doing he fell asleep and had a dream that would become the subject of the first sonnet in La Vita Nuova.

    Afterward, there were only two other short meetings between the two: one in the church of Santa Margherita dei Cerchi (the church visited by Robert Langdon and Sienna Brooks in Dan Brown’s Inferno) and one at a wedding feast.
